Woven vs Knit Tops

One of the first decisions is whether the garment will use woven or knitted fabric.

Woven Tops

Woven fabrics can be suitable for structured and fashion-led silhouettes such as shirts, blouses and detailed tops.

Production may involve elements such as:

  • Collars
  • Cuffs
  • Plackets
  • Pleats
  • Frills
  • Gathers
  • Panels
  • Button detailing

Because many woven fabrics offer less natural stretch, pattern accuracy and fit become particularly important.

Knit Tops

Knitted fabrics generally offer greater stretch and flexibility.

Depending on the product, they can work well for casual silhouettes, T-shirts and other comfort-led styles.

The machinery, construction methods and production requirements can therefore differ considerably between woven and knit garments.

A manufacturer capable of handling both gives brands more flexibility when developing broader collections.


Why Sampling Matters for Women’s Tops

A design may look perfect on paper but behave differently once converted into fabric.

Sampling helps evaluate:

  • Overall silhouette
  • Fit
  • Neckline
  • Sleeve construction
  • Garment length
  • Drape
  • Fabric suitability
  • Stitching
  • Design details

Consider something as simple as a frill.

Its width, gathering ratio, placement and fabric behaviour can completely change the appearance of the garment.

Correcting these details during sampling is considerably easier than discovering them after hundreds of pieces have already been manufactured.

Choosing Fabric for Women’s Tops

Fabric can completely transform the same silhouette.

Brands should consider characteristics such as:

Drape

Should the top fall softly or maintain structure?

Weight

Is the fabric appropriate for the intended season and silhouette?

Handfeel

How should the garment feel against the skin?

Opacity

Will lining or another construction solution be required?

Shrinkage

How will the material behave after washing?

Colour

Can the required shade be reproduced consistently across production?

Fabric selection should therefore be considered alongside design development rather than treated as a separate decision.


Manufacturing Detailed Women’s Tops

Fashion tops can contain significantly more construction detail than basic garments.

A design might combine:

Frills + Pleats + Buttons + Gathered Sleeves + Multiple Panels

Every additional feature creates another production checkpoint.

Manufacturers need to ensure those details remain consistent across the entire order—not only on the approved sample.

For fashion brands, this is one reason reviewing a manufacturer’s previous sample developments is valuable before committing to production.

What Should Buyers Check Before Placing a Bulk Tops Order?

Before confirming production, review the following.

1. Product Experience

Ask whether the manufacturer has previously developed women’s tops similar to your designs.

2. Sample Quality

Evaluate fit, construction, stitching and finishing before committing to bulk.

3. Production Capacity

Ensure the factory can support both the initial order and potential repeat production.

4. Quality Control

Ask how measurements, workmanship and consistency are monitored during production.

5. Communication

Clear communication becomes increasingly important when multiple styles, colours and approvals are involved.

6. Export Experience

International buyers should also consider whether the manufacturer understands export production, packing and buyer requirements.
